Ehrman Mansion Open House

      Walk through Pine Lodge, the mansion built by Isaias Hellman in 1903. Experience the lavish lifestyle enjoyed by his daughter, Florence Hellman Ehrman, and three generations of family and friends who spent 60 summers at their private lakefront retreat.

"General" William Phipps' Cabin
The cabin of the West Shore’s first homesteader from 1860 is open to the public. This is the one day of the year that you can walk into his cabin and view his pioneer life.

Vintage Car Display
In the 1930s some visitors made the trek from San Francisco to Tahoe in luxurious automobiles. Select vintage vehicles owned by Tahoe collectors are on display.

Theater
Lake of the Sky:

The Saga of Lake Tahoe Part II
 This documentary film is narrated by area resident and Star Trek actor, Leonard Nimoy. The film features spectacular views of Lake Tahoe and thorough coverage of Pine Lodge history. Continuous showings are in the theater in the rear of the nature center.
